How You'll Contribute
The Physical Therapist is responsible for evaluating patients and implementing medically prescribed physical therapy treatment plans tailored to individual needs. The therapist conducts comprehensive assessments, establishes appropriate goals, and develops personalized interventions to restore function, reduce pain, prevent disability, and promote mobility. Treatments may include therapeutic exercises, manual techniques, and the use of physical agents and assistive devices. The Physical Therapist educates patients on injury prevention, ergonomics, and rehabilitation strategies, while also supervising and delegating tasks to physical therapy assistants, students, and support personnel in accordance with clinical and regulatory standards. Progress is continuously monitored and documented, with plans modified as needed to ensure optimal patient outcomes.

Lifepoint Health is a leader in community-based care and driven by a mission of Making Communities Healthier. Our diversified healthcare delivery network spans 29 states and includes 63 community hospital campuses, 32 rehabilitation and behavioral health hospitals, and more than 170 additional sites of care across the healthcare continuum, such as acute rehabilitation units, outpatient centers and post-acute care facilities.
